The General Lifespan of a Fire Extinguisher

The National Fire Protection Association recommends replacing your fire extinguisher every 10 years, regardless of whether or not it has been used. However, this is just a general guideline. The lifespan of a fire extinguisher depends on several factors, such as how often it’s been used, how it’s been maintained, and the environment in which it’s been stored.

Signs That Your Fire Extinguisher Needs to Be Replaced

It’s essential to inspect your fire extinguisher regularly for signs that it needs to be replaced. Some common signs include:

  • The pressure gauge is in the red
  • The safety pin is missing or broken
  • The nozzle is damaged or blocked
  • The fire extinguisher has been used before
  • The label or instructions are unclear or damaged

Proper Maintenance of Fire Extinguishers

Proper maintenance can help extend the lifespan of your fire extinguisher. Some tips include:

  • Checking the pressure gauge monthly to ensure that it’s in the green zone
  • Inspecting the fire extinguisher for any damages or signs of wear and tear
  • Ensuring that the fire extinguisher is easily accessible and visible
  • Taking the extinguisher in for professional service and recharge every six years or as recommended by the manufacturer
